Norwegian Krone
The Norwegian Krone (NOK) is the official currency of Norway, used for everyday transactions and monetary exchanges within the country.
History/Origin
The Norwegian Krone was introduced in 1875, replacing the Norwegian Speciedaler, and has undergone various reforms, including decimalization in 1875 and decimal standardization in 1963. It has been Norway's official currency since then.
Current Use
The NOK is actively used in Norway for all financial transactions, including banking, commerce, and international trade. It is also traded on the foreign exchange market and is considered a stable currency within the region.
North Korean Won
The North Korean Won (KPW) is the official currency of North Korea, used for everyday transactions within the country.
History/Origin
The North Korean Won was first introduced in 1947, replacing the Korean won used during the Japanese occupation, and has undergone several redenominations and reforms since then.
Current Use
Today, the KPW is primarily used domestically in North Korea, with limited acceptance outside the country; it is subject to strict government control and currency regulations.
